What Is Dry Pack Mortar | Advantages of Dry Pack Mortar | Disadvantages of Dry Pack Mortar

CivilJungle

Introduction of Dry Pack Mortar. Dry pack mortar simply is a mixture of cement, sand, and water in the appropriate proportion. Dry pack mortar is also known as deck mud or floor mud. Dry pack mortar is used for repairing the concrete cracks and to fill up the deep holes in the concrete. What Is Dry Pack Mortar?
